In this engaging episode of the Healthy Project Podcast, host Corey Dion Lewis sits down with the incredibly dynamic Dr. BCW, hailed as one of the most active figures in healthcare advocacy. Dive into a candid conversation exploring the critical importance of vaccinations, especially for the historically marginalized and vulnerable populations amidst the backdrop of the COVID-19 pandemic. Dr. BCW and Corey dissect the persistent healthcare disparities, the role of trust and authenticity in combating misinformation, and the pathways to delivering inclusive healthcare. This episode is a must-listen for anyone interested in understanding the complex layers of healthcare delivery, the power of vaccination, and the strategies to combat misinformation in the age of social media.


Shownotes:

  • [00:01.267] Introduction to Dr. BCW, a beacon of healthcare advocacy and empowerment.
  • [00:27.726] The significance of friendships and connections in healthcare.
  • [01:25.358] Dr. BCW's perspective on vulnerable populations and the necessity of vaccination.
  • [03:02.259] The challenge of intentionality in providing care to marginalized communities.
  • [03:46.99] Lessons learned about community health and vaccination efforts during the pandemic.
  • [06:06.286] Strategies for combating misinformation and the importance of health literacy.
  • [08:14.636] The role of community engagement and personal motivation in healthcare delivery.
  • [10:40.142] Approaches for healthcare providers to battle misinformation without relying on social media.
  • [12:29.038] Dr. BCW's message on the importance of informed decision-making regarding vaccinations.
  • [14:43.502] Where to find Dr. BCW: Website, social media platforms, and her impactful TEDx talk on maternal health.
